1990s Fender Custom Shop Tone-Master CSR-3 Blonde Piggyback Tube Amp w/ Celestions

Up for sale, a 1990s Fender Custom Shop Tone-Master CSR-3 amplifier and 2x12” cabinet in excellent condition and in perfect working order. Designed by amp guru Bruce Zinky and only produced from 1993-2002, this premium Fender Custom Shop amplifier has been a rig mainstay for artists including Jimmy Page, Dave Grohl, and Joe Perry. Prized for their muscular sound and absolutely crushing high volume gain, this 100 watt amplifier is lean and mean with a touch-sensitive feel, plenty of headroom for cleans, and a fantastically multi-dimensional tone with dense harmonics.
Part vintage-inspired, part modern power and aggression, the Tone-Master CSR-3 is a two-channel (Vintage and Drive), single-input design, with a two-way Fat switch on each channel for extra midrange thickness. The clean (Vintage) channel offers great headroom before moving into creamy vintage tube breakup territory around 7 on the dial, and both channels feature a three-band EQ. The circuit is largely untouched, and the tube complement comprises a quartet of 5881 power tubes (three original Fender, one properly biased and matched Sovtek replacement) and three 12AX7 preamp valves.
The 2x12” cabinet is crafted from birch plywood with a closed-back design, loaded with a pair of Celestion G12-80 Classic Lead 12” speakers: these ceramic speakers are tight and controlled with impressive low-mid punch and aggression, and a powerful treble response that’s tempered in its highest frequencies.
Both the amp and cabinet feature rough blonde tolex, oxblood grillcloth, and flat Pre-CBS-style Fender badges. Wear is limited to a few faint stains and scuffs on both enclosures, and the graphics on the amp faceplate are pristine, with all of the original cream barrel knobs present.
